Over the past few weeks, I’ve been refining how I think about building systems—and more importantly, how they should behave once they’re in the hands of real users. Most platforms try to be everything: dashboards, frameworks, plugins, automation layers, all loosely stitched together. The result is usually flexibility at the cost of control. What I’m building with Plank goes in the opposite direction. It’s not a dashboard. It’s not a plugin manager. It’s not a framework in the traditional sense. It’s a governed system. Every component, plugins, pages, permissions, data flows, operates within a defined structure. No shadow systems. No side-loading logic. No ambiguity in how something gets registered, rendered, or executed. That constraint is intentional. Because at scale, the problem isn’t adding features, it’s maintaining clarity, security, and predictability as complexity grows. The goal isn’t to make something that can do anything. The goal is to make something that can be trusted to do exactly what it’s supposed to do, every time. Still early. But the direction is getting sharper.

🚨 CRITICAL: Active supply chain attack on axios -- one of npm's most depended-on packages. The latest axios@1.14.1 now pulls in plain-crypto-js@4.2.1, a package that did not exist before today. This is a live compromise. This is textbook supply chain installer malware. axios has 100M+ weekly downloads. Every npm install pulling the latest version is potentially compromised right now. Socket AI analysis confirms this is malware. plain-crypto-js is an obfuscated dropper/loader that: • Deobfuscates embedded payloads and operational strings at runtime • Dynamically loads fs, os, and execSync to evade static analysis • Executes decoded shell commands • Stages and copies payload files into OS temp and Windows ProgramData directories • Deletes and renames artifacts post-execution to destroy forensic evidence If you use axios, pin your version immediately and audit your lockfiles. Do not upgrade.
